  • MyCEB HIGHLIGHTS THE MALAYSIAN BUSINESS EVENTS INDUSTRY AT IBTM WORLD 2023

    BARCELONA – 29 NOVEMBER 2023:Malaysia Convention & Exhibition Bureau (MyCEB), in collaboration with 15 respected industry partners, has made an impactful appearance at IBTM World Barcelona for the 13th consecutive year. There are many business partners at IBTM World.

     

    Held from 28-30 November at Fira Barcelona Gran Via, this year’s participation marked a significant endeavour by MyCEB and partners in positioning the country as the preferred business events destination in Asia.

     

    “The main objective behind this participation is to establish Malaysia as a preferred destination for business events, emphasising the country capabilities and world-class offerings. Secondly, MyCEB seeks to provide invaluable firsthand insights into the ever-evolving industry to international travel trade buyers. Finally, our participation is a concerted effort to create networking opportunities, foster fruitful collaborations, and secure new business contracts, further amplifying Malaysia's role on the global stage,”says Mr. Azman Haji Tambi Chik, CEO of MyCEB

     

    The Malaysian entourage’s presence at IBTM World Barcelona yielded a range of positive outcomes and numerous networking opportunities which opened accessibility into new markets. This strategic participation underscores Malaysia& commitment to fostering new partnerships and growth in this dynamic industry.

     

    “I firmly believe that IBTM World has always been and will continue to be a strategic platform for us as it is one of the avenues that opens up to the European and international market. This is my first tradeshow as I took office this month and I am delighted to be part of this occasion and look forward to conclude successful meetings with some of the world& biggest players,” Mr. Azman continues.

     

    MyCEB since its establishment in 2011 has charted a track record of supporting 2857 business events, which brings around 2.3 million delegates and contributed some RM17.4 billion in estimated economic impact. This year alone, the national bureau has successfully secured 305 events from the year 2023 – 2030 which translates to RM4.8 billion in estimated economic impact.

     

    Some of the successful bid wins that will take place in Malaysia include International Conference on Emergency Medicine (ICEM) 2027, ENLIT ASIA 2024 and Federation of Asian and Oceanic Physiological Societies 2027 which will cumulatively generate RM57.26 million or 11.23 million Euros in estimated economic impact.

  • WINNER, WINNER, CHICKEN DINNER: KFC MALAYSIA AND PUBG SERVE UP A RECIPE FOR VICTORY.

    Embarking on this exciting collaboration, KFC Malaysia and PUBG are set to deliver exclusive in-game rewards, adding an extra layer of thrill and incentive for gamers participating in this unique venture.

    The KFC, PUBG: Battlegrounds, and PUBG Mobile partnership brings customers an exciting new promotion, unlocking exclusive in-game rewards with the purchase of special KFC PUBG meals, starting October 11, 2023, while stocks last.

    When KFC customers purchase the Gamer Box, they will score in-game finger-lickin’ good loot straight from the Colonel’s kitchen. The rewards include up to six battle cosmetics in KFC’s signature red and white brand colors and inspired by KFC’s craveable tastes, allowing PUBG: BATTLEGROUNDS and PUBG MOBILE gamers to indulge all their senses. Players will also experience exciting KFC in-game visuals and digital experiences.

    In addition to these tasty in-game treats, players can savor the flavor and experience the collaboration in the real world. Fans can “load up, dive in,” and order at participating KFC restaurants, on the KFC app, or via KFC.com. to enjoy the special Gamer Box, which includes a Zinger Burger, one chicken, one fries (M), one 6 pc. O.R. Nuggets, one Coleslaw (S), and one drink.

    For a limited time during this collaboration, PUBG Mobile players can look forward to indulging their senses with virtual dining experiences in KFC Royale Restaurants across the Erangel, Miramar, Nusa, and Livik maps. These in-game KFC restaurants will offer players the opportunity to feast on mouthwatering KFC delicacies, each with their own distinct health or energy boosts, to help them take home the win. Players will also be able to gear up with KFC-themed items, including the KFC Royale Colonel Set, Chicken Champ Cover and Set, Royale Delight Top and Parachute, Seasoned Squad Graffiti, and Crispy Crunch Avatar Frame.

    While playing PUBG: Battlegrounds, players will have the exciting opportunity to acquire KFC-themed in-game items and encounter KFC restaurants on the Erangel map. Inside these KFC restaurants, players can explore a variety of themed items available at the kiosks, including the KFC Chicken Box, KFC French Fries, and KFC Energy Drink, each offering health benefits. Game gear, wins, and accessories include the KFC-themed Colonel’s Bucket Hat, Colonel’s Jacket, Colonel’s Shorts, Colonel’s Clogs, Colonel’s Parachute, and “It’s Finger Lickin’ Good” Spray. Players will also be exposed to crave-worthy KFC in-game visuals such as the statue of Colonel Sanders, kiosks issuing health benefits, a plane banner, electric billboards, and a map decal.
